As a Staff Data Engineer on the Data Platform team, you’ll be architecting and developing Underdog’s sports focused data systems and data pipelines
Design, build, and optimize scalable data platform infrastructure to support batch and real-time data processing and storage on the cloud
Implement and maintain monitoring, alerting, and logging mechanisms to ensure the health and performance of the data platform
Collaborate with data scientists, engineers, and business stakeholders to understand data requirements and translate them into scalable technical solutions
Mentor junior engineers, lead technical initiatives, and drive results in a fast-paced, dynamic environment
Lead code reviews, provide constructive feedback, and evangelize best practices to maintain code and data quality
Research and keep up to date on emerging data technologies and trends and focus on iteratively implementing them into Underdog’s data systems
Who you are:
At least 7 years of experience building scalable and durable data pipelines and data systems on a cloud environment (e.g. AWS, GCP, Azure)
Highly focused on delivering results for internal and external stakeholders in a fast-paced, entrepreneurial environment
Excellent leadership and communication skills with ability to influence and collaborate with stakeholders
Strong familiarity with distributed computing and data storage mechanisms on the cloud environment with hands-on experience in managing data infrastructure
Familiarity with containerization and orchestration technologies such as Docker, Kubernetes, or ECS
Experience with data streaming frameworks such as Apache Kafka, Apache Flink, or Kinesis
Advanced proficiency with Go, Python, or other OOP languages (at least 2)
Advanced proficiency with SQL
Experience with DevOps practices such as CI/CD pipelines, and infrastructure-as-code tools (e.g. Terraform, CDK)
Even better if you have:
Strong interest in sports
Prior experience in the sports betting industry
Knowledge of ML concepts, with some experience in building inference systems
Our targeted compensation rate for this position is between $185,000 and $250,000, depending on experience, plus equity. Think your skills are exceptional and warrant higher pay? Apply anyway! If we agree, we're willing to negotiate.
This job is no longer open
Outer Join is the premier job board for remote jobs in data science, analytics, and engineering.